Father's Day Gifts: Photo Booth Bookmark


Each year for Father's Day and Mother's Day we try to make a little something creative for the Grandpas.  Last year we made cutout photo bookmarks.  This year I decided to do something similar.

I took several photos of the kids close up on the porch.
 
 

Then I printed the photos b&w in a strip, laminated them and added a ribbon.  Easy, quick "photo booth" bookmarks.  I made one for my husband and myself as well.

Photo Cube


I made this photo cube for my husband for Father's Day this year. I cut out a 3 1/2 inch square block. My two year old painted it black for me. I printed pictures of the kiddos in black & white and then I mod podged them on.

Suit Card


Here's a card I've made several times over the last few years. I've used it for missionary farewells and for Father's Day. You could also use it as a congrats on a new job for a guy. I like to pop up the collar with glue dots and sew on a real button.
